Warm Continental destinations such as Sapporo enjoy summer temperatures that fluctuate between 20°C and 28°C (68°F to 82°F), with some heatwaves leading to even hotter days. Winters are mostly cold and snowy, with average temperatures ranging from -5°C to 0°C (23°F to 32°F). Travelers can enjoy the vibrant autumn scenery, ski during the winter season, or enjoy the comfortable to warm summer months.
If you're planning a trip to Sapporo, the best time to visit is from late spring through the end of summer, when the weather is pleasantly warm from May to August. Winters can be quite cold, with frost occurring almost every month from November to March and regular snowfall. This makes the mountainous regions perfect for winter sports, offering great opportunities for a winter getaway as well!

The distance between Penticton and Sapporo is 4,402 miles (7,085 kilometers).
However, because there are no direct flights between YYF and CTS, the full journey covers a distance of 4,435 miles (7,137 kilometers).
Flights between Penticton and Sapporo take 10 hours and 13 minutes.
Please note that these times refer to the actual flight times, excluding the stopover time in between connecting flights, as this depends on your stopover airport as well as your date(s) of travel.
There are 2 airports in Sapporo: Chitose International Airport (CTS) and Sapporo Okadama Airport (OKD).
